Overview
- The 15‑second AI‑generated clip was first obtained and reported June 9 by the Daily Caller and shows a Talarico deepfake in a dress singing a parody about transgender children.
- Citizens for Sanity paid for a six‑figure ad buy for the spot and the group is known for large dark‑money expenditures, including roughly $93 million in 2022.
- The ad repurposes a 2023 Talarico remark about “trans children” while critics note he has recently walked back provocative comments and said he opposes gender‑reassignment surgery for minors.
- Legal limits on synthetic political material are uneven: Ballotpedia and reporting show 31 states have some deepfake rules and Texas bars distribution of deepfakes within 30 days of an election.
- The buy sharpens the race’s focus on social issues, draws sharply different reactions from conservative and progressive outlets, and could push renewed scrutiny of AI use and outside spending in campaigns.
